tobacco pipe cleaning
Cleaning tobacco pipes is essential to ensure an optimal smoke and prolong the life of the accessory. Here are some key steps to follow to keep your pipe in optimal condition:- After each use, empty the ash and tobacco residues from the pipe.- Use a pipe cleaner or a specific tool to remove any residues inside the bowl.- Pass a pipe cleaner (cotton wire) through the stem to eliminate any tar residues.- Clean the external surface of the pipe with a soft cloth to remove any traces of smoke and grease.By regularly following these simple steps, you can fully enjoy your favorite tobacco pipe.
